You can not select more than 25 topics
			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
		
		
		
		
		
			
		
			
				
					
					
						
							20 lines
						
					
					
						
							385 B
						
					
					
				
			
		
		
	
	
							20 lines
						
					
					
						
							385 B
						
					
					
				# distutils: language = c++
 | 
						|
# cython: language_level=3
 | 
						|
 | 
						|
cdef extern from "framereader.h":
 | 
						|
  cdef cppclass CFrameReader "FrameReader":
 | 
						|
    CFrameReader(const char *)
 | 
						|
    char *get(int)
 | 
						|
 | 
						|
cdef class FrameReader():
 | 
						|
  cdef CFrameReader *fr
 | 
						|
 | 
						|
  def __cinit__(self, fn):
 | 
						|
    self.fr = new CFrameReader(fn)
 | 
						|
 | 
						|
  def __dealloc__(self):
 | 
						|
    del self.fr
 | 
						|
 | 
						|
  def get(self, idx):
 | 
						|
    self.fr.get(idx)
 | 
						|
 | 
						|
 |